Android

Kuinka asentaa python centos 8: een

How to Install and Configure Git and GitHub on Windows

How to Install and Configure Git and GitHub on Windows

Sisällysluettelo:

Anonim

Python on yksi suosituimmista ohjelmointikieleistä maailmassa. Yksinkertaisen ja helppo oppia olevan syntaksin avulla Python on suosittu valinta aloittelijoille ja kokeneille kehittäjille.

Toisin kuin muut Linux-levitykset, Pythonia ei ole asennettu oletuksena CentOS 8: een.

Kuten jo tiedät, on olemassa kaksi Python-versiota, joita kehitetään aktiivisesti. Vaikka Python 2 on hyvin tuettu ja aktiivinen, Python 3: ta pidetään kielen nykyisyytenä ja tulevaisuutena.

Oletuksena RHEL / CentOS 8: lla ei ole muuntamatonta koko järjestelmän kattavaa python komentoa käyttäjien lukitsemisen estämiseksi tiettyyn Python-versioon. Sen sijaan se antaa käyttäjälle mahdollisuuden asentaa, määrittää ja suorittaa tietty Python-versio. Järjestelmätyökalut, kuten yum käyttävät sisäistä Python-binaaria ja kirjastoja.

Tämä opas opastaa sinut asentamaan Python 3 ja Python 2 CentOS 8: een.

Python 3: n asentaminen CentOS 8: een

Asenna Python 3 CentOS 8: lle suorittamalla seuraava komento pääkäyttäjänä tai sudo -käyttäjänä terminaalissa:

sudo dnf install python3

Varmista asennus tarkistamalla Python-versio kirjoittamalla:

python3 --version

Tämän artikkelin kirjoittamishetkellä PyOSS 3: n uusin versio, joka on saatavana CentOS-arkistoissa, on ”3.6.x”:

Python 3.6.8

Komento myös asentaa pip.

Python-ohjelman suorittamiseksi sinun on kirjoitettava nimenomaisesti python3 ja ajaa pip-tyyppi pip3 .

Sinun tulisi aina mieluummin asentaa jakeluun toimitetut python-moduulit käyttämällä yum tai dnf koska niitä tuetaan ja testataan toimimaan oikein CentOS 8: ssa. Käytä pipia vain virtuaaliympäristössä. Python Virtual Environments -sovelluksen avulla voit asentaa Python-moduuleja erilliseen sijaintiin tiettyä projektia varten sen sijaan, että asennettaisiin globaalisti. Tällä tavalla sinun ei tarvitse huolehtia muihin Python-projekteihin vaikuttamisesta.

Python 3 -moduulipakettien nimet ovat etuliitettä "python3". Voit esimerkiksi asentaa paramiko-moduulin suorittamalla:

sudo dnf install python3-paramiko

Python 2: n asentaminen CentOS 8: een

Python 2 -paketit sisältyvät myös oletus CentOS 8 -varastoihin.

Asenna Python 2 kirjoittamalla seuraava komento:

sudo dnf install python2

Varmista asennus kirjoittamalla:

python2 --version

Lähdön tulisi näyttää noin:

Python 2.7.15

Suorita Python 2, kirjoita python2 ja ajaa pip-tyyppi pip2 .

Aseta Python-oletusversio (muuntamaton Python-komento)

Aseta Python 3 järjestelmänlaajuiseksi muuntamattomaksi python-komentoksi alternatives apuohjelman avulla:

sudo alternatives --set python /usr/bin/python3

Kirjoita Python 2: lle:

sudo alternatives --set python /usr/bin/python2

alternatives komento luo symlink- python joka osoittaa määritettyyn python-versioon.

Kirjoita python --version terminaaliin, ja sinun pitäisi nähdä oletus Python-versio.

Voit muuttaa oletusversiota käyttämällä jotakin yllä olevista komennoista. Jos haluat poistaa muuntamattoman python-komennon, kirjoita:

sudo alternatives --auto python

johtopäätös

CentOS 8: ssa Pythonia ei ole asennettu oletuksena.

Asenna Python 3 kirjoittamalla dnf install python3 ja asentaaksesi Python 2 kirjoittamalla dnf install python2 .

python pip virtenv centos